While treadmills might seem uncomplicated, various types cater to various needs and preferences. Here are the primary classifications:

Manual Treadmills: These require no power and are moved by the user's effort. They often use up less space and are quieter however can provide a steeper learning curve for beginners.

Electric or Motorized Treadmills: The most common type, they include automatic programs for speed and incline. They are normally more flexible but need electricity to operate.

Folding Treadmills: Designed for those with minimal area, folding treadmills can be collapsed and kept away when not in usage, making them ideal for little apartment or condos.

Slope Treadmills: These machines use the ability to raise the incline, imitating hill runs for a more reliable exercise.

Business Treadmills: Built for heavy usage, these machines are generally found in fitness centers and gym and feature a variety of features and toughness.

A1: It is generally recommended to use a treadmill at least 3 times each week for 30-60 minutes to see considerable outcomes.
Q2: Can I slim down utilizing a treadmill?
A2: Yes, with a mix of regular workout, a balanced diet plan, and portion control, using a treadmill can contribute greatly to weight loss.
Q3: Do I need to warm-up before using the treadmill?
A3: Yes, warming up is important to prepare your body, lower the threat of injury, and improve workout performance.
Q4: Is running on a treadmill as effective as running outdoors?
A4: Both have benefits, but a treadmill enables controlled environments, avoiding weather-related interruptions, and may have less influence on the joints.
Q5: Can a treadmill aid with muscle structure?
A5: While primarily a cardiovascular tool, changing inclines can assist engage and reinforce specific leg muscles.
